    In this lesson you will learn how to play rhythm guitar in style of Eddie Van Halen. The riff is based on E minor blues pentatonic.
    When you are practicing this lesson make sure to pay a lot of attention to drums and bass. You have to be a little behind the bit to make it sound groovy!

    Standard Tuning: E-B-G-D-A-E

    Tempo: 110
